About This Novel
In a house in Anning Village, two people lived. The man is the applicant who chooses to start over because of unforgettable pain and grief. The woman is the inspector, responsible for teaching the man a series of simple things and their uses - what language is, what a name is, how to dress, how to go down the stairs, what actions to take when facing others, and record his healing process. He had forgotten most of these things and had no memory of why he was here. He felt safe in this paradigm of life. During this period, the man's condition recurred many times, and his past cognitions once again invaded his purified brain. When he meets an attractive, emotionally volatile woman at a party, he questions everything he's learned. What is this village for? Why is he here? Has he ever been someone else, and will he truly become the person he is allowed to be?
